Tag: Tripping

Screen Shot 2014-05-19 at 6.03.04 PM

Royce Hall Admits to Experimenting with LSD

WESTWOOD – Famous UCLA structure, Royce Hall, recently admitted to having experimented with the psychoactive drug, LSD, this last week. According to several friends and students, the iconic building began “acting quite differently” leading up to the event. This marks…